Jun Miho (美保 純, Miho Jun, born 4 August 1960) is a Japanese actress. She is affiliated with Knockout.

Title: Heavenly Blue
Character: Tomoko Hata
Released: December 12, 1994
Type: TV
Winner of the 10th Art Works Award. The film depicts the "ultimate love" in which a man who is a murderer and a woman who doesn't believe in love meet by chance and eventually fall in love with each other. "A drama adaptation of Ayako Sono's original work of the same name, which is based on the "Okubo Kiyoshi Incident," which actually happened. The script was written by Yumiko Inoue. Koichi Sato plays the role of a ruthless murderer who murders women one after another, and Kaori Momoi plays the role of a woman who falls in love with such a murderer. It was broadcast on terrestrial TV in the "Saturday Drama" slot.
